The anticipation of the major cultural event beats high waves: Chemnitz became the cultural capital of Europe in 2025 and rocks the stage with an exciting program! Visitors can look forward to spectacular exhibitions in the city's museums, which not only present the history, but also the identity of the East.

The State Museum of Archeology Chemnitz (SMAC), with the captivating exhibition "Silver Gloss and Friend Das", shows the challenges and achievements of mining right from the start. Under the title "Tales of Transformation", the Chemnitz industrial museum will explore the concise of former industrial cities in Europe from April 2025. In the same month, the exhibition "European Realities" in the Gunzenhauser Museum takes you into the fascinating world of realism of the 1920s and 1930s. Another highlight will be the exhibition on the passionate work of the Norwegian painter Edvard Munch, who deals with the topic of fear and from August 2025 the paintings will shine in new light.

In September 2025, the Chemnitz Theater celebrates the highly expected premiere of "Rummelplatz", an impressive opera, based on the novel of the same name by the author Werner Bräunig, born in Chemnitz. The connection between opera and history will captivate the audience.

The event "#3000Garagen" highlights the variety of East German identity, while from January 2025 around 100 garage portraits of photographer Maria Sturm bring the stories of the garages built in the GDR. These garage courtyards become living meeting points for the community through various festivals, workshops and creative actions. The so -called Purple Path, an impressive course with sculptures of national and international artists, also combines touching memories with contemporary art and will make Chemnitz even more radiant.

In addition to Chemnitz, the cities of Nova Gorica in Slovenia and Gorizia in Italy will shine on the cultural parquet in Slovenia and Gorizia in 2025.
